Scott Bis

Global Business Director at W. R. Grace & Co.

Scott Bis has a diverse and extensive work experience in various industries. Scott started their career at Dow in 1993 as a Senior Research Chemist in the Agricultural Chemicals Process Research Lab, where they developed cost-effective synthesis strategies for potential agrochemicals. Scott then moved to Dow AgroSciences in 1998 as a Senior Scientist in the Insect Management-Discovery Research team, focusing on designing and synthesizing molecules with broad-spectrum activity against insect pests.

In 2001, Scott joined Dow's Advanced Electronic Materials R&D as a Senior Development Specialist, leading Six Sigma projects in both R&D and manufacturing. Scott later became a Senior Development Specialist in the Superabsorbent Products TS&D division, where they guided customer support activities and led a qualification program. Scott then transitioned to Dow Coating Materials R&D, where they held roles as a Research Leader and Senior Research Manager, overseeing innovation portfolios and leading R&D teams for the development of waterborne maintenance and protective coatings. Scott also served as an Associate Marketing Director, responsible for sustainability and licensing activities, as well as coordinating regional and global initiatives.

In 2013, Scott joined Kemin Industries as the Global Director of Research and Development, managing the R&D team for Kemin Nutrisurance and providing innovative solutions to the petfood and petfood ingredients industry. Scott later held the position of Vice President of Research and Development and Vice President of Marketing.

In 2021, Scott worked as a Global Business Director at both Albemarle Corporation and W. R. Grace & Co., overseeing teams of professionals and acquiring profitable partnerships in the fine chemical manufacturing services sector.

Throughout their career, Scott Bis has demonstrated strong leadership and expertise in research and development, marketing, business development, and collaboration with cross-functional teams.

Scott Bis earned a Bachelor of Science degree in Chemistry from Saginaw Valley State University in 1989. Scott then pursued a Ph.D. in Chemistry at Wayne State University from 1989 to 1993. Later, they obtained an M.B.A. in Executive Management from the DeVos School of Management at Northwood University between 2007 and 2009.
